Overview
Age of Empires II (Retired) offers a classic real-time strategy experience, transporting players back to a beloved era of historical warfare and empire building. While this edition is no longer updated, it faithfully preserves the core gameplay that made the original a legend. Players can dive into the original single-player campaigns from Age of Kings and The Conquerors expansion, commanding one of 18 distinct civilizations across a millennium of history. The game also features robust multiplayer options, allowing players to test their strategic prowess against others online in a bid for global dominance.

Game Info
Originally developed by Ensemble Studios and later re-imagined by Hidden Path Entertainment, Skybox Labs, and Forgotten Empires, Age of Empires II (Retired) was released on April 9, 2013. It supports single-player and multiplayer modes and is available in multiple languages, including English, German, French, Italian, Spanish, Russian, Japanese, and Simplified Chinese. The game is rated for all ages and features Steam Achievements and Trading Cards.
